Performance and Quality Improvement Program

 

Harborcreek Youth Services administers a fully-developed Performance and Quality Improvement Program (PQI). The program is designed in a manner consistent with national standards as established by the Council on Accreditation (COA). Quality enhancement activities focus on the need for the organization to promote efficient and effective service delivery and the achievement of strategic and program goals.

Agency leadership has established quality expectations and broad strategic goals that merit overview. Both internal and external stakeholder participation in the quality enhancement process is encouraged. Similarly, results of improvement initiatives are communicated regularly to a diverse group of agency constituents.

Harborcreek selects performance measurement indicators that relate to primary agency domains such as management, operations, program results, and client outcomes. We collect measurable data in aggregate form in order to identify patterns and trends such as case record review reports, client satisfaction data, compliance, and pilot project outcome measurement.

Currently, HYS has an extensive system of sub-committees in six (6) performance improvement areas:

  1. Health and Safety (Accidents/risk prevention strategies)

  2. Clinical Review (Service quality/client outcomes)

  3. Incident Review (Safe behavior management)

  4. Human Resources (Staff satisfaction/staff training)

  5. Compliance and Risk Management (HIPPA and regulatory bodies)

  6. Education (Special Education and psycho-educational program)

  7. Pilot Project Work Groups (Expressive Therapies and specialized clinical services)
